So I copied all of my music from my OG onto my computer which took maybe 15-20 minutes. Now trying to copy it onto my GN using MTP and its taking forever. It says its going to take over an hour and from the looks of how far along I am I'm starting to believe that's pretty accurate. I've read that MTP sucks for large numbers of files (which with album art etc I've got over 2000 files to transfer) but is this normal for MTP?


Edit: Nevermind, finally noticed that I wasn't using a high speed USB port. Changed to one of those and its going much faster. Mod, please close this thread.
